This is the shocking moment police ran in to separate a street fight between women that saw a man appear to try to stab one of them with a pair of keys.
Officers rushed in to break up the brawl which was watched by a least a dozen people shortly before 1am on a street corner in Manor Park, East London.
Police tried to calm the situation and were heard shouting 'stay over there', 'move out the way' and 'Slow down, who's been stabbed, where's she been stabbed?'
Detectives then arrested two women in their 20s on suspicion of causing grievous bodily harm and took them to police stations before releasing them on bail.
